Adamawa Politics: APC Faces Challenges Ahead of Elections

The political dynamics in Adamawa State are shifting as the All Progressives Congress (APC) navigates a complex electoral landscape. The APC, under the leadership of figures like Abdulrahman Bashir Hask, is attempting to consolidate its position after recent gains.
The party faces significant challenges from the People's Democratic Party (PDP), led by Governor Ahmadu Umaru Fintiri, and the African Democratic Congress (ADC), which is gaining traction with experienced political actors such as Aisha Dahiru and Abbo Jibrilla Bindow. APC's internal dynamics are also crucial, as the party seeks to mobilize grassroots support and maintain its electoral advantage.
Recent visits by President Bola Ahmed Tinubu to Yola have highlighted the importance of grassroots mobilization, which is essential for sustaining electoral victories. The political environment is marked by strategic calculations and coalition-building efforts, as the APC prepares for the upcoming elections amid a backdrop of evolving political alliances and rivalries.
